Ever wondered why some cache pages on geocaching.com are vibrant and full of colour whilst others appear rather plain!

The answer is that some cache pages are created using HTML whereas others are pretty much just text on a page.

The following are links to web pages that explain how to brighten up your cache pages with HTML content.

These tutorials were prepared by Texas geocaching and gpscachers.
